From an insurance agent to building a local powerhouse, Jayanthi Elangoven took one of life’s biggest risks — betting on herself. Fourteen years ago, she stepped into the heat of Singapore’s competitive food scene and launched Srisun— now a beloved 24/7 neighbourhood eatery known for its crispy pratas, comforting local dishes, and irresistible dessert plates.
In this episode, we sit down with the woman behind the griddle to uncover the real story: The early hustle, the pageant sparkle, the café-style reinvention of her Serangoon Gardens outlet, and the quiet strength that carried her through it all. Jayanthi reminds us that courage doesn’t always wait for perfect timing — sometimes, it just starts with fire.
